Paige Niemann, the social media star with an uncanny resemblance to Ariana, has shared a heartwarming message from the singer herself. The revelation is a poignant moment in Paiges' new six-part documentary series 'Turning The Paige', now streaming on Apple TV.
The documentary chronicles Paige's journey from viral sensation to her own identity, as she navigates life beyond being known solely for mimicking Ariana Grande. In one gripping episode, Paige delves into the moment when she received a direct message from the pop icon in 2019. This came after Ariana reportedly stumbled upon videos of Paige perfecting her Grande impression and even bringing Cat Valentine to life.
According to Paige, Ariana's words of wisdom stated: "I am flattered and I'm sure you're very sweet. But I just wanted you to know, I looked back a little way on your page and I think someone should tell you if they haven't today that you're very beautiful as YOURSELF." The message goes on to advise Paige on embracing her natural appearance: "Without all the make-up and trying to make your face look more similar to someone else's and whatnot. I had to say it because it is the truth. Always do what makes you happy, of course, but if I didn't say that to you, I'd regret it. You're beautiful as you are. Take care."
Paige first captured the hearts of millions on TikTok in 2019 with her meticulous recreations of Ariana's signature style, including her high ponytail and winged eyeliner. At the time, even Ariana herself weighed in, describing the impersonations as "bizarre" while praising Paige for being "the sweetest."
